Understanding Your Franchi 48 AL’s Foundation
Overview
The Franchi 48 AL’s enduring appeal comes from its elegant design, and the stock plays a vital role in this. This semi-automatic shotgun employs a unique inertia-driven operating system known for its simplicity and efficiency. The stock isn’t just a place to rest your cheek; it’s an integral component that influences balance, handling, and overall shooting comfort.
Materials and Construction
Most factory-original Franchi 48 AL shotguns came equipped with a stock crafted from either walnut wood or a durable synthetic polymer. Walnut stocks exude a classic aesthetic, known for their warmth, rich grain patterns, and feeling of traditional craftsmanship. Synthetic stocks, on the other hand, offered greater resilience to the elements, boasting resistance to moisture, temperature fluctuations, and the occasional accidental bump or scrape. The choice between wood and synthetic often came down to personal preference, the shooter’s intended use, and, in some cases, the budget.
Stock Variations
While the fundamental design remained relatively consistent throughout the 48 AL’s production life, there might be slight variations depending on the model year, or special edition. Identifying the specific configuration of your Franchi 48 AL is important when selecting a replacement stock. This might include the length of pull (the distance from the trigger to the end of the stock), the drop at the comb (the vertical distance from the top of the stock to the line of sight), and drop at the heel (the vertical distance from the top of the stock to the heel).
Common Problems
Over time, even the most well-cared-for Franchi 48 AL stock can experience wear and tear. Wood stocks, especially, are susceptible to cracking, splintering, and finish degradation. Constant exposure to recoil, fluctuations in humidity, and the general rigors of hunting and shooting can contribute to these issues. Synthetic stocks, while more resilient, are not immune to damage; impacts, scratches, and even the loosening of the buttpad can occur. Recognizing these potential problems is crucial to ensuring your Franchi 48 AL functions reliably and continues to look its best.

Types of Replacement Stocks
So, where do you begin? You need to consider a few key choices, namely which type of replacement stock fits best with your requirements. You can opt for an option that maintains the original look. When selecting a replacement that mirrors the factory original, you’ll primarily have two paths.
Original Style Replacements
Wood Replacements: If your goal is to stay true to the gun’s classic appearance, a wood stock is the way to go. You will have the choice of different types of wood, such as walnut or beechwood. Wood stocks can often be refinished, allowing you to breathe new life into your firearm. However, keep in mind that wood requires regular maintenance to keep it looking its best, including periodic cleaning, oiling, and the prevention of damage from moisture.
Synthetic Replacements: These stocks offer superior durability and weather resistance. They are often made from rugged polymers or reinforced composites. Synthetic options are a practical choice for hunters who frequently face wet or harsh conditions. They also tend to be more affordable than high-quality wood stocks.
Aftermarket Stocks
Beyond these options, you also have access to the world of aftermarket products, offering the chance to personalize your Franchi 48 AL to your individual tastes and shooting requirements. These aftermarket stocks can often bring modern advancements to your classic firearm.
Different Materials: The options become broader. While synthetic stocks remain prevalent, you might discover stocks crafted from advanced materials, such as carbon fiber. These materials can offer exceptional strength-to-weight ratios, potentially reducing the overall weight of your shotgun and improving handling.
Adjustable Features: Certain aftermarket stocks provide adjustable features. This can include adjustable length of pull, to customize the stock’s reach to your specific body type; adjustable cheek pieces, for refining your sight alignment and ensuring a proper cheek weld; or adjustable recoil pads, for greater comfort and decreased felt recoil.

Maintenance and Care
Proper care and maintenance are essential for preserving the integrity and beauty of your Franchi 48 AL stock.
Cleaning and Maintenance
Regularly clean your stock, removing any dirt, grime, or residue that might accumulate. For wood stocks, apply a quality gun oil or finish to protect the wood from the elements and keep its appearance looking great.
Preventing Damage
Take precautions to avoid damage. Protect the stock from moisture. Handle your firearm carefully to avoid scratches or impacts. Store your Franchi 48 AL in a gun safe or case when not in use to protect it from the elements and prevent accidental damage.
Common Issues and Troubleshooting
Even with proper care, problems can arise. Being able to identify and address these issues can save you time and money.
Stock Fit Problems
If your new stock doesn’t fit properly, inspect the receiver inletting. If the inletting isn’t right, return the stock.
Cracking or Splitting
For wood stocks, minor cracks or splits can sometimes be repaired using epoxy and wood fillers. More severe damage might require professional gunsmith assistance or replacement.
